Centrifugal barrel tumbling machines are the fastest and most cost-effective method for deburring and/or polishing large quantities of metal parts at once. Also known as an industrial tumbler, rotary tumbler or harperizer system, a centrifugal barrel finishing machine uses a cyclical sliding action to grind the metal surface. Centrifugal barrel finishing is a type of mass finishing.

Metal finishing is the process of altering an object's surface in order to improve its appearance and/or durability. Metal finishing is related to electroplating, which is the electrodeposition of a thin surface coating of metal onto another.
